  • Bay to Breakers celebrates its 100th year in 2011. One of the largest footraces in the world, participants dress in costumes or in their birthday suit, and run or walk from the Embarcadero, through Golden Gate Park, and end at Ocean Beach. Floats and alcohol have finally been banned since the primary sponsor bowed out last year due to the bad press the race garnered. However, plenty of people will, most likely, still be boozing along the course. Definitely a sight to see!
